Greatest element on right side
WebAmazon, Microsoft, Google, Facebook, Netflix, AppleGiven an array "arr", replace every element in that array with the greatest element among the elements to ... WebMar 2, 2024 · Problem Statement: Given an array, print all the elements which are leaders.A Leader is an element that is greater than all of the elements on its right side in the array. Examples: Example 1: Input: arr = [4, 7, 1, 0] Output: 7 1 0 Explanation: Rightmost element is always a leader. 7 and 1 are greater than the elements in their right …
Greatest element on right side
Did you know?
WebAug 11, 2024 · Input: arr = [17,18,5,4,6,1] Output: [18,6,6,6,1,-1] Explanation: - index 0 --> the greatest element to the right of index 0 is index 1 (18). - index 1 --> the greatest … WebFeb 5, 2024 · The very intuitive solution is to start from the first element in the array and move to the right one by one. At each element, we find the maximum number on the …
WebJul 11, 2016 · This question already has answers here: Greatest element present on the right side of every element in an array (3 answers) Closed 6 years ago. Given an array … WebReplace Elements with Greatest Element on Right Side - LeetCode That topic does not exist.
WebYou are given an array Arr of size N. Replace every element with the next greatest element (greatest element on its right side) in the array. Also, since there is no element next to the last element, replace it with -1. Example 1: Input: N = WebMar 25, 2024 · Can you solve this real interview question? Replace Elements with Greatest Element on Right Side - Given an array arr, replace every element in that array with the greatest element among the elements to its right, and replace the last element with -1. After doing so, return the array. Example 1: Input: arr = [17,18,5,4,6,1] Output: …
WebHere’s another stack-based solution where elements are processed from right to left in the array. For each element x in the array, loop, till we have a greater element on top of the stack or stack, becomes empty.; Once the stack contains a greater element on the top, set it as the next greater element of x and push x on top of the stack. If the stack becomes …
WebA simple solution is to check if every array element has a successor to its right or not by using nested loops. The outer loop picks elements from left to right of the array, and the inner loop searches for the smallest element greater than the picked element and replaces the picked element with it. Following is the C, Java, and Python program ... how many round tables fit under a 20x20 tentWebSep 15, 2024 · To solve the problem mentioned above the main idea is to use a Stack Data Structure . Iterate through the linked list and insert the value and position of elements of the linked list into a stack. Initialize the result vector with -1 for every node. Update the previous node’s value while the current node’s value is greater than the previous ... how dhrable is furniture board laminate paperhttp://www.crazyforcode.com/replace-element-next-greatest-array/ how many rounds per minute minigunWebSep 15,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. how dhoni came to indian cricket teamWebGiven a string, we have to count the number of larger elements on right side of each character. Let's see an example. Input. string = "abc" Output. 2 1 0. There are 2 larger elements than a on its right side. There is 1 larger element than b on its right side. There are 0 larger elements than c on its right side. Algorithm. Initialise the string. how many round towers in irelandWebCode to Replace Elements with Greatest Element on Right Side Leetcode Solution C++ code #include using namespace std; vector … how many rounds on a nfl gameWebAug 23, 2024 · Solution 2: One loop. With last index as -1, we can start from the rightmost element, move to the left side one by one, and keep track of the maximum element. Replace every element with the maximum element. newArr [3] is equal to the maximum number among arr [4] to arr [5]. This is also equal to the maximum number among arr [4] … how many rounds were fired at breonna taylor